1. Snorkel with Sea Turtles at Akumal Bay

Snorkeling in Akumal Bay is a must-do experience. The bay is famous for its friendly sea turtles. As you glide through the clear water, you’ll see these magnificent creatures swimming gracefully around you.

The vibrant coral reefs surrounding the bay make the snorkeling even more exciting. You can spot colorful fish and other marine life swimming alongside the turtles. It’s like entering a whole new world underwater!

Many local guides offer snorkeling tours, ensuring you have a safe and fun experience. They provide all the necessary equipment, including masks, fins, and snorkels. Plus, they will share tips on the best spots to see turtles and other animals.

Remember to respect the wildlife. Keep a safe distance from the turtles and don’t touch them. This helps protect their natural habitat and keeps them safe.

After an exciting day of snorkeling, you can relax on the beach and soak up the sun. Akumal Bay’s stunning scenery is the perfect backdrop for a memorable day.

7. Go Scuba Diving at the Mesoamerican Barrier Reef

Scuba diving at the Mesoamerican Barrier Reef is an unforgettable adventure. This reef is the second largest in the world and teems with marine life. Divers can explore vibrant coral formations and encounter a diverse range of sea creatures.

Experienced dive shops in Akumal offer guided trips for all skill levels. Whether you are a beginner or an expert, you can find a suitable dive. Friendly instructors ensure safety while showing you the best spots to explore.

Underwater, you will admire the colorful fish, sea turtles, and even nurse sharks. The visibility is often excellent, allowing you to appreciate the beauty of the reef fully. Each dive brings new discoveries and memorable moments.

Don’t forget to take a waterproof camera! Capturing the mesmerizing sights underwater will let you relive your adventure when you return home.

Diving at the Mesoamerican Barrier Reef is not just a thrilling experience; it’s also a unique opportunity to witness the importance of ocean conservation. You’ll leave with a deep appreciation for the underwater world.

9. Discover the Ancient Mayan Ruins of Tulum Nearby

The ancient Mayan ruins in Tulum are a fantastic day trip from Akumal. Located on a cliff overlooking the Caribbean Sea, these ruins offer stunning views and a glimpse into history. Explore the well-preserved structures and learn about the ancient civilization.

Guided tours are available, ensuring you gain insight into the significance of each area. The most notable structure is El Castillo, the Temple of the Descending God. The stories behind the ruins will captivate your imagination.

After exploring the ruins, unwind at the beach located nearby. The turquoise waters and soft sand create a perfect relaxation spot. Swimming near the ruins allows you to enjoy the combination of history and natural beauty.

Bringing a camera is a must! The picturesque scenery and fascinating structures provide endless photography opportunities. You will want to capture these moments to remember your trip.

A visit to the Tulum ruins blends adventure, history, and stunning views, making it a memorable experience on your Akumal trip.
